6 Differing kinds of Needs Documentation

Needs Documents are accustomed to correctly and unambiguously convey the wants of a company. A company Specifications Document is usually a nicely-acknowledged 'prerequisites' document even so there are actually other types of needs files which have been also essential in progressing a undertaking by to completion. The template of the Requirement Document for use relies upon on the type of specifications that it's intended to seize. Organizations create and adapt their own personal templates to accommodate their needs.

Company Needs Doc (BRD)
It defines the significant amount company targets and Main capabilities of an item. It is ready by a company analyst or perhaps a undertaking supervisor. It has sections to explain the challenge scope, functional, non-practical, info and interface demands. It offers a very good idea of the types of customers and their expectations. It provides an concept of the proposed process within the standpoint of the company Business that commissions the program.

Useful Prerequisites Document
It describes in detail, the solutions supplied by the program. It specifies the sequence of functions, inputs, outputs, facts saved and computational procedures For each and every functionality. It captures the actions of your system for every event and user action. Text descriptions are supported by wire diagrams for better comprehending.

High quality Specifications Document
This document describes the acceptance requirements for your stop solution. It states exactly what the stop consumers expects from your program with regards to throughput, response time, dependability, disaster recovery, fail Secure mechanisms, maintainability, accessibility, load handling capability, portability and robustness. These are also termed as non-functional requirements.

Technical Requirements Doc
Program, Components and System demands of the ultimate merchandise are described On this document. Software program requirements state what programming language the procedure need to be formulated on, what software package might be accustomed to accessibility the program and the type of database. Components necessities condition the processor pace, memory dimension, disk Area, network configuration and Qalyptus potential of the applying and databases servers for being deployed once the system goes live (output natural environment). System needs state the constraints on the procedure's natural environment and the constraints within the technologies to be used when constructing the program. If the procedure will be to be deployed in a number of places, the hardware and program natural environment of every place is described. The doc lists the limitations for being viewed as while designing the procedure architecture.

Consumer Interface Needs Document
It describes the feel and appear on the Graphical User Interface (GUI) of the process. It defines the positioning of consumer input fields, messages, menus, header and footer on the applying display. It explains how the screens are going to be accessed with the user and the sequence of person actions for every approach. It includes mock-up screen photographs to give the project staff an concept of just what the conclude item will appear to be. It demonstrates:

• How the content material is introduced on the user
• Coloration codes to be used
• User navigation
• Hints / recommendations / recommendations to generally be exhibited to the user to the display
• "Save facts and carry on Procedure later on" options if the user has got to enter a large amount of details to the method
Shortcut-keys for frequently applied functions

Sector Needs Document (MRD)
It defines the demands of the end consumer from the process (i.e. consumers of the corporation for which the technique is to be deployed). This doc is prepared by promoting managers, product or service professionals or business enterprise analysts. It defines the program's capabilities in accordance with The present sector pattern and anticipations in the qualified client foundation. It lists functions that provide the organization a aggressive advantage available in the market.

Leave a Reply

Your email address will not be published. Required fields are marked *